What is CO2e?
Carbon dioxide equivalent (CO2e) is a universal measure used to express the environmental impact of various greenhouse gases (GHGs) by converting them into the equivalent impact of carbon dioxide (CO2). This calculation accounts for the global warming potential (GWP) of each gas, ensuring a standardized metric for comparing emissions. For instance, CO2e evaluates emissions like methane or nitrous oxide in terms of their equivalent effects on global warming compared to CO2.

Key Features
- CO2e Data Integration:
- CO2e values are calculated for individual components based on their weight and environmental impact. This allows teams to evaluate the carbon footprint of every electronic part in their BOM.
- When a BOM is uploaded to Supplyframe, the solution first analyzes each Manufacturer Part Number (MPN) to identify the component's 'Part Category' and 'Weight'. It then cross-references this identified 'Part Category' with a 'CO2e Factor Provider' to retrieve the associated 'CO2 Factor.' Finally, the CO2e per part is calculated by multiplying the weight of the component and its corresponding CO2 factor. This ensures precise and reliable CO2e assessments for every component.
- Comprehensive Calculation & Transparency:
- CO2e values are calculated at the package level, offering an indication of the carbon impact for parts on printed circuit boards (PCBs).
- CO2e metrics are presented alongside other BOM data, such as pricing, excess costs, and risk indices, enabling comprehensive and informed decision-making.
